htmljs动态时钟(js实现动态的数字时钟)
1、lthtml 这段代码创建了一个简单的 HTML 页面,其中包含了一个时间表,显示了当前的日期和时间JavaScript 部分使用了 Date 对象来获取当前的日期和时间,并通过将其内容更新到页面上的相应元素中来实现动态更新setInterva。
2、1新建一个HTML页面2新建一个idweitimer的P标签,来动态显示日期时分秒3编写JS函数获得当前日期,然后根据当前日期获得年月日时分秒然后每隔一秒执行一次该函数就实现了动态日期4运行效果。
3、JS显示动态的日期时间,参考如下ltbody ltspan id=quotlocaltimequot20131030 123302 星期三ltspan ltscript type=quottextjavascriptquot function showLocaleobjD var str,colorhead,colorfoot var。
4、oDivinnerHTML=quot现在的时间是quot+year+quot年quot+month+quot月quot+day+quot日 quot+hour+quotquot+minues+quotquot+second theTime 执行时间函数 setIntervaltheTime,1000 更新时间 ltscript lt。
5、a获取当前时间Date并将当前时间信息转换为一个6位的字符串b根据时间字符串每个位置对应的数字来更改图片的src的值,从而实现更换显示图片构建HTML基础并添加样式ltdiv id=quotdiv1quot ltimg src=#39数字时钟1。
6、2将文档命名为index,用记事本打开 3写入一下代码,如图lthtml xmlns=quot lthead ltmeta。
7、pink#39, #39maroon#39 钟表颜色数组 setIntervalfunction var now = new Date clockinnerHTML = nowgetFullYear + #39年#39 + nowgetMonth+1 + #39月#39 + nowgetDate。
8、lt!DOCTYPE html lthtml lang=quotenquot lthead ltmeta。
9、虽然前面已经有高手回答了, 可毕竟我也写了, 就贴上吧 lt!DOCTYPE htmllthtml lang=quotenquot xmlns=quotlthead ltmeta charset=quotutf8quot lttitlelttitle ltstyle #my。
10、Javascript就是适应动态网页制作的需要而诞生的一种新的编程语言,如今越来越在HTML基础上,使用Javascript可以开发交互式Web网页Javascript的出现使得网页如果已经存在一个Javascript源文件通常以js为扩展名,则可以采用这种引用的。
11、lt!DOCTYPE html lthtml lthead ltmeta charset=quotutf8quot lttitlelttitle lthead ltbody ltstyle type=quottextcssquot#myTime color whiteborderstyle solidbackgroundcolor blackwid。
12、JS代码如下获取上下文文档对象 var clock = documentgetElementById#39clock#39 var cxt = clockgetContext#392d#39 画指针 function drawPointerwidth, color, value, angle, startx, starty, endx。
13、function judgFailTime var x = quot20100928 142526quot 取得的TextBox中的时间 var time = new Datexreplacequotquot,quotquotvar b = 20 分钟数 timesetMinutestimegetMinutes + b。
14、documentgetElementByIdquotnowquotvalue = now input的html是now这个字符串 setTimeoutquotshowquot,1000 设置过1000毫秒就是1秒,调用show方法 ltscript ltbody onLoad=quotshowquot lt! 网页加载时调用。
15、函数upDate 要写在onload外面,写在里面只能作为局部对象,下次调用的时候会提示找不到对象 function upDatevar aImg=documentgetElementsByTagName#39img#39var i=0var oDate=new Date var str = toDoubleo。